What happened to him? -&gt; He went over the Sea, to the undying lands, to find healing and rest from the hurts he had come by in Middle-earth

And what about Sam and the others? What happens to them? -&gt; Sam, also went over the Sea in his own time, He was voted Mayor of the Shire some six or seven times. Merry and Pippin lived long and happy lives, and had great honor. When they got old and tired the took a last journey south and took leave with their respective lords, The King of Rohan and Gondor. They were laid to rest in Rath Dinen.

Is there a sequal to LotR or anything else explaining this? -&gt; As Mhoram said. I will only add 'Unfinished Tales' by JRR Tolkien. Toilkien also started a sequal called The New Shadow, but it never got far, and was never finished.

And what of this land over the sea? What's Frodo doing over there? Erėssa, Aman, Valinor - The land of the Lords of the arda - The Valar. If you want to learn more about them you need to read The Silmarillion.
